Как перевести PDF в Excel: 10 проверенных способов с программами и онлайн-сервисами

Конвертация табличных данных из PDF в Excel часто заканчивается искажёнными колонками, потерянными формулами или нечитаемыми символами — особенно если файл содержит сложные структуры, графики или нестандартные шрифты. Проблема не в самом формате, а в выборе инструмента: универсальные конвертеры (вроде Adobe Acrobat или Microsoft Word) справляются с простыми документами, но для профессиональной работы с отчётами, финансовыми ведомостями или сканами нужны специализированные решения. Ниже — подробный разбор программ, онлайн-сервисов и плагинов, которые сохранят структуру данных, распознают текст со сканов и даже восстановят частично повреждённые файлы.

Ключевые критерии выбора инструмента зависят от типа PDF:

  • 📄 Текстовые PDF (созданные из Excel/Word) — подойдут любые конвертеры с поддержкой OCR.
  • 🖼️ Сканы или фотографии таблиц — требуют OCR-движок (например, ABBYY FineReader или Online2PDF).
  • 📊 PDF с формулами/графиками — только платные решения (Nitro PDF, PDFelement) или ручная доводка в Excel.
  • 🔒 Защищённые паролем PDF — нужны программы с функцией снятия защиты (Icecream PDF Converter).

Если вам нужно срочно преобразовать один файл, достаточно бесплатного онлайн-сервиса. Для регулярной работы с сотнями документов рациональнее купить десктопную программу с пакетной обработкой. В статье — тесты точности конвертации, сравнение скорости и инструкции по настройке каждого инструмента.

1. Десктопные программы для конвертации PDF в Excel

Локальные программы выигрывают у онлайн-сервисов по трём параметрам: безопасность (файлы не загружаются на сторонние серверы), скорость (нет ограничений по размеру) и дополнительные функции (пакетная обработка, OCR, редактирование перед экспортом). Минус — большинство платные, но есть легальные бесплатные версии с урезанным функционалом.

Лидеры рынка среди десктопных решений:

  • 🥇 ABBYY FineReader PDF 16 — лучший OCR для сканов (распознаёт 190+ языков, восстанавливает таблицы с точностью 99,8%).
  • 🥈 Adobe Acrobat Pro DC — стандарт для корпоративных пользователей (интеграция с Microsoft 365, облачное хранилище).
  • 🥉 Nitro PDF Pro — бюджетная альтернатива Adobe (поддерживает макросы Excel при конвертации).
  • 💰 PDFelement — оптимален для бухгалтеров (сохраняет формулы, поддерживает 1C-отчёты).
  • 🆓 Icecream PDF Converter — бесплатная версия с ограничением 2 файлов в день.

Для теста мы взяли PDF-отчёт с 50 страницами (таблицы, графики, текст) и сравнили результаты:

Программа Точность таблиц OCR (сканы) Скорость (50 стр.) Цена (руб.)
ABBYY FineReader 99% Да (190+ языков) 1 мин 20 сек 12 990 (пожизненно)
Adobe Acrobat Pro 95% Да (ограничено) 2 мин 10 сек 1 416/мес (подписка)
Nitro PDF Pro 97% Да (только англ.) 1 мин 45 сек 8 990 (пожизненно)
Icecream PDF (беспл.) 85% Нет 3 мин 30 сек 0

Важно: Adobe Acrobat и Nitro PDF при конвертации сложных таблиц могут "склеивать" ячейки — проверяйте результат вручную. Если в PDF есть мердженные ячейки (объединённые), их придётся восстанавливать в Excel через Главная → Объединить и поместить в центре.

📊 Какую программу вы используете для конвертации PDF в Excel?
Adobe Acrobat
ABBYY FineReader
Онлайн-сервисы
Другую (напишите в комментариях)
Не конвертирую

2. Онлайн-сервисы: быстро, но с ограничениями

Бесплатные онлайн-конвертеры удобны для разовых задач, но имеют критические недостатки:

  • ⚠️ Ограничение по размеру (обычно до 50 МБ).
  • ⚠️ Риск утечки данных (файлы хранятся на серверах до 24 часов).
  • ⚠️ Нет OCR для сканов (кроме Online2PDF и Smallpdf).

Топ-5 сервисов по соотношению качества и безопасности:

  1. iLovePDF — сохраняет формулы, но искажает графики.
  2. Smallpdf — лучший OCR среди онлайн-сервисов (платно).
  3. Online2PDF — поддерживает пакетную обработку (до 20 файлов).
  4. PDF2Go — бесплатно распознаёт текст на 30+ языках.
  5. Zamzar — отправляет результат на email (удобно для больших файлов).

Инструкция для iLovePDF (самый популярный сервис):

  1. Перейдите на страницу конвертации.
  2. Загрузите файл с компьютера, Google Drive или Dropbox.
  3. Выберите формат XLSX (для Excel 2007+) или XLS (для старых версий).
  4. Нажмите Конвертировать в EXCEL и скачайте результат.

Удалите конфиденциальные данные из файла

Проверьте размер (до 50 МБ)

Убедитесь, что PDF не защищён паролем

Выберите сервис с OCR, если конвертируете скан-->

⚠️ Внимание: Онлайн-сервисы могут добавлять водяные знаки в бесплатной версии или ограничивать количество страниц. Например, Smallpdf бесплатно обрабатывает только первые 3 страницы PDF.

3. Плагины для Excel и Google Таблиц

Если вы постоянно работаете с PDF в Excel или Google Sheets, удобнее установить плагин, который интегрируется прямо в интерфейс таблиц. Такие решения экономят время на импорт/экспорт и часто предлагают дополнительные функции (например, сравнение версий файлов).

Лучшие плагины для Excel:

  • 📌 Ablebits PDF Converter — встраивается в ленту Excel, поддерживает пакетную обработку.
  • 📌 Kutools for Excel — конвертирует PDF в Excel и обратно, сохраняет форматирование.
  • 📌 ASAP Utilities — бесплатный плагин с базовыми функциями импорта.

Для Google Таблиц подойдёт расширение PDF.co:

  1. Установите расширение из Google Workspace Marketplace.
  2. Откройте Google ТаблицуРасширения → PDF.co → Import from PDF.
  3. Загрузите файл и выберите лист для импорта.

⚠️ Внимание: Плагины для Excel могут конфликтовать с макросами. Перед установкой сохраните резервную копию файла и отключите макросы через Файл → Параметры → Центр управления безопасностью → Параметры центра управления безопасностью → Настройка макросов.

4. Конвертация через Microsoft Word: обходной путь

Microsoft Word умеет открывать PDF и сохранять их в формате .docx, который затем можно импортировать в Excel. Этот способ бесплатный и работает без интернета, но подходит только для простых таблиц без формул. Алгоритм:

  1. Откройте PDF в Word (правый клик по файлу → Открыть с помощью → Word).
  2. Дождитесь распознавания (может занять до 5 минут для больших файлов).
  3. Скопируйте таблицу (Ctrl+C) и вставьте в Excel (Ctrl+V).
  4. Исправьте искажения через Главная → Формат → Автоподбор ширины столбца.

Плюсы метода:

  • ✅ Бесплатно (если есть Microsoft Office).
  • ✅ Сохраняет базовое форматирование (жирный текст, цвета).

Минусы:

  • ❌ Искажает сложные таблицы (объединённые ячейки, многоуровневые заголовки).
  • ❌ Не распознаёт сканы (нужен OCR).
  • ❌ Теряет формулы (превращает в статичные значения).

Как исправить "склеенные" ячейки после вставки в Excel

1. Выделите проблемный диапазон.

2. Перейдите на вкладку Данные → Текст по столбцам.

3. Выберите С разделителями → Пробел/Табуляция.

4. Нажмите Готово — ячейки разделятся автоматически.

5. Специализированные решения для бухгалтеров и аналитиков

Если вы работаете с финансовыми отчётами, 1C-выгрузками или данными из банк-клиентов, обычные конвертеры не подойдут — они не сохраняют структуру проводок, не распознают печатные формы (например, 2-НДФЛ или баланс по ОКУД) и искажают суммы с копейками. Для таких задач нужны узкоспециализированные программы:

  • 💼 1C:Конвертация данных — интегрируется с 1C, распознаёт типовые формы отчётности.
  • 💼 Альт-Инвест Прим — конвертирует PDF-выписки банков в Excel с сохранением реквизитов.
  • 💼 FineReader для бухгалтерии — пакетная обработка сканов первички (счета, накладные).

Пример: конвертация выписки из Сбербанк Бизнес Онлайн в Excel через Альт-Инвест Прим:

  1. Экспортируйте выписку из банк-клиента в PDF.
  2. Откройте файл в Альт-Инвест Прим.
  3. Выберите шаблон Сбербанк (юридические лица).
  4. Нажмите Конвертировать — программа автоматически разобьёт данные по колонкам: дата, сумма, контрагент, назначение платежа.

⚠️ Внимание: При конвертации банковских выписок проверьте:
  • Сохранились ли БИК и корреспондентские счета (часто теряются в универсальных конвертерах).
  • Корректно ли распознаны суммы с копейками (например, 1 234,56, а не 1234.56).
  • Нет ли дублирования строк (характерно для Adobe Acrobat при пакетной обработке).

6. Ошибки конвертации и как их избежать

Даже лучшие программы дают сбои. Типичные проблемы и способы их решения:

Ошибка Причина Решение
Таблица "съехала" PDF создан из изображения, а не текста Используйте OCR (ABBYY FineReader или Online2PDF)
Кириллица отображается кракозябрами Некорректная кодировка PDF Пересохраните PDF в UTF-8 через Notepad++
Формулы превратились в текст PDF не содержит данных о формулах Восстановите формулы вручную или используйте Nitro PDF Pro
Файл не открывается после конвертации Повреждён исходный PDF Восстановите PDF через PDF2Go Repair

Если конвертер выдаёт ошибку "Файл защищён от редактирования", попробуйте:

  1. Удалите пароль через LostMyPass (онлайн).
  2. Используйте Icecream PDF Converter (есть функция снятия защиты).
  3. Откройте PDF в Google Chrome (правый клик → Открыть с помощью), затем сохраните как новый файл (Ctrl+P → Сохранить как PDF).

🔹 Наличие защиты (Файл → Свойства → Безопасность)

🔹 Тип содержимого (текст или изображение)

🔹 Кодировку (откройте в Notepad++, должна быть UTF-8)-->

7. Альтернативные методы: Python и командная строка

Для автоматизации конвертации сотен файлов подойдут скрипты на Python с библиотеками PyPDF2 и tabula-py. Пример кода для извлечения таблиц из PDF:

# Установите библиотеки:

pip install tabula-py pandas

import tabula

import pandas as pd

Читаем PDF и конвертируем все таблицы в DataFrame

dfs = tabula.read_pdf("отчет.pdf", pages="all", multiple_tables=True)

Сохраняем каждую таблицу в отдельный лист Excel

with pd.ExcelWriter("результат.xlsx") as writer:

for i, df in enumerate(dfs):

df.to_excel(writer, sheet_name=f"Таблица_{i+1}", index=False)

Для запуска скрипта:

  1. Установите Python 3.10+.
  2. Скопируйте код в файл convert.py.
  3. Поместите PDF в ту же папку, что и скрипт.
  4. Запустите командой python convert.py.

Преимущества метода:

  • ✅ Пакетная обработка (например, 500 файлов за раз).
  • ✅ Настройка под специфические форматы (например, только таблицы с заголовком "Баланс").
  • ✅ Бесплатно и без ограничений по размеру файлов.

⚠️ Внимание: Скрипт на tabula-py не распознаёт сканы — только текстовые PDF. Для OCR используйте комбинацию с pytesseract (требует установки Tesseract-OCR).

FAQ: Частые вопросы о конвертации PDF в Excel

Можно ли конвертировать PDF в Excel бесплатно без потери качества?

Да, но с оговорками:

  • Для простых текстовых PDF подойдёт iLovePDF или PDF2Go (бесплатно до 50 МБ).
  • Для сканов — только Online2PDF (бесплатный OCR, но ограничение 15 файлов в час).
  • Для сложных таблиц бесплатные сервисы искажают данные — используйте пробную версию ABBYY FineReader (7 дней).

Почему после конвертации в Excel вместо букв отображаются вопросительные знаки?

Проблема в кодировке PDF. Решения:

  1. Пересохраните PDF в UTF-8 через Online UTF8 Tools.
  2. Откройте исходный PDF в Notepad++ и выберите кодировку UTF-8 без BOM.
  3. Используйте конвертер с поддержкой кириллицы (например, ABBYY FineReader).

Как конвертировать PDF в Excel на телефоне (Android/iOS)?summary>

Мобильные приложения для конвертации:

  • 📱 Adobe Scan (Android/iOS) — фотографирует таблицу и распознаёт текст (OCR).
  • 📱 CamScanner — экспортирует в Excel через облако (платно).
  • 📱 PDF to Excel Converter (только Android) — бесплатно, но с рекламой.

Для iPhone также подойдёт Shortcuts (автоматизация через Конвертировать PDF в текстСкопировать в Excel).

Можно ли автоматизировать конвертацию для 100+ файлов в день?

Да, используйте:

  • Плагины: Kutools for Excel (пакетная обработка).
  • Скрипты: Python с tabula-py (пример кода в разделе 7).
  • Программы: ABBYY FineReader (автоматизация через Горячие папки).

Для корпоративных задач подойдёт Adobe Acrobat Pro DC с функцией Action Wizard (настройка цепочки действий для пакетной конвертации).

Как восстановить формулы после конвертации PDF в Excel?

Формулы в PDF хранятся как статичные значения — их нельзя восстановить автоматически. Решения:

  1. Сравните исходный Excel-файл (если есть) с конвертированным через Главная → Сравнить файлыExcel 2019+).
  2. Используйте Nitro PDF Pro — он частично сохраняет формулы при экспорте из Excel в PDF и обратно.
  3. Восстановите формулы вручную:
    =СУММ(B2:B10)  →  Замените на =SUM(B2:B10)
    

    =ЕСЛИ(A1>10;"Да";"Нет") → =IF(A1>10,"Да","Нет")